How can organizations ensure that employees are empowered to take autonomous actions while still maintaining accountability and alignment with company goals and values?
Organizations can ensure that employees are empowered to take autonomous actions by providing clear guidelines and expectations, fostering a culture of trust and open communication, and offering opportunities for ongoing training and development. It is important for leaders to set a strong example of accountability and alignment with company goals and values, and to regularly check in with employees to provide feedback and support. By creating a supportive and empowering environment, organizations can encourage autonomy while ensuring that employees remain accountable and aligned with the company's overall mission and objectives.
